Umeda sits at the northern end of Osaka’s city center and functions as a major commercial and transit district. The area is home to several interconnected shopping complexes, underground arcades, and flagship department stores, all woven together by a dense network of railway lines and pedestrian pathways. The Osaka shopping scene near Umeda is dense and varied. Grand Front Osaka, located directly adjacent to JR Osaka Station, is a large mixed-use complex featuring retail shops, restaurants, and exhibition spaces spread across its North and South buildings. Hankyu Grand Building and HEP Five are also within easy walking distance, each offering distinct retail environments. HEP Five is particularly recognizable for the giant red Ferris wheel mounted on its rooftop. The underground shopping arcade known as Whity Umeda connects several of these destinations, providing a comfortable, weather-protected route through the district.
Department Store Opening Hours in Umeda
Department stores in Umeda generally open between 10:00 and 11:00 in the morning and close between 20:00 and 21:00 in the evening. Hankyu Department Store, one of the flagship retail destinations in the area, typically operates on these hours, though specific floors or sections may have slightly different schedules. Daimaru Umeda and Hanshin Department Store follow similar patterns. It is worth noting that hours can vary on public holidays and during special sales periods, so checking the official website of each store before your visit is advisable. Some basement food halls, known locally as depachika, may open slightly earlier or close later than the main shopping floors.
Umeda Railway Station Train Schedules
Umeda is served by multiple railway operators, making it one of the best-connected transit hubs in western Japan. JR Osaka Station, Hankyu Umeda Station, Hanshin Umeda Station, and the Osaka Metro Umeda Station all operate within close proximity, offering connections to destinations across the Kansai region and beyond. Train services typically begin around 5:00 in the morning and run until midnight, with varying frequency depending on the line and time of day. During peak commuting hours, trains on major lines run every few minutes. Visitors traveling between Osaka, Kyoto, Kobe, and Nara will find Umeda a particularly convenient starting point for day trips.
Restaurants in Umeda Arcade
The dining options within and around the Umeda arcades are extensive. The underground shopping corridors and the upper floors of major department stores house hundreds of restaurants representing a wide range of cuisines. From traditional Japanese ramen and sushi counters to international options including Italian, Korean, and French cuisine, there is rarely a shortage of choices. The restaurant floors in Grand Front Osaka and the upper levels of Hankyu Department Store are especially well regarded for variety and quality. The depachika basement food halls also offer prepared foods, bento boxes, confectionery, and fresh produce from across Japan, making them popular for both quick meals and takeaway.
Parking Facilities Near Umeda Mall
For those arriving by car, parking near Umeda is available but can be limited and relatively expensive during busy periods. Several parking structures are attached to or located near the major shopping complexes. Grand Front Osaka operates its own multi-story parking facility, and additional public parking is available beneath Osaka Station City. Hankyu Department Store and Daimaru also provide parking for customers, often with validation or discounted rates for shoppers who spend above a certain threshold. It is generally recommended to use public transport when visiting Umeda, as the area’s train and subway connections are extremely efficient. However, for those who prefer driving, arriving early in the day or on weekday mornings can help secure a spot more easily.
